0

当用户将鼠标悬停在一个小缩略图上时,我希望该图像替换背景图像。

如何使用 Javascript/JQuery 做到这一点?

4

2 回答 2

3
$('thumbnail id').hover(function(){
    $(this).css('background-image','new image');
});
于 2012-11-19T22:33:51.347 回答
1

JQuery 的悬停会解决这个问题。基本上,您想获取图像并设置其悬停功能以设置背景图像(如果这是您想要的行为,则在悬停时取消设置)

$('#tumbnail_id').hover(function() {
    // set the background
}, function() {
    // unset the background
});

假设您的缩略图 HTML 标记的 id 为tumbnail_id. 如果你有几个缩略图,你可以用你的选择器和 CSS 类做一些更聪明的事情,但这是添加悬停功能的基础。

于 2012-11-19T22:39:29.560 回答